The Role of METS-IR in Early Screening for Gestational Diabetes Mellitus in Chinese Women: A Two-Center Prospective Study

作者:Junxiang Gao, Shuoning Song, Yanbei Duo, Shihan Wang, Xiaolin Qiao, Yuemei Zhang, Jiyu Xu, Jing Zhang, Xiaorui Nie, Qiujin Sun, Xianchun Yang, Ailing Wang, Wei Sun, Yong Fu, Mengmeng Zhang, Yingyue Dong, Zechun Lu, Tao Yuan, Weigang Zhao · 发表于:Diabetes Metabolic Syndrome and Obesity · 年份:2025 · DOI:10.2147/dmso.s538992 · 被引用次数:5 · 研究领域:Gestational Diabetes Research and Management、Pregnancy and preeclampsia studies、Birth, Development, and Health

Objective: This two-center prospective cohort study aimed to evaluate the predictive value of the Metabolic Score for Insulin Resistance (METS-IR) for gestational diabetes mellitus (GDM) in Chinese women during early pregnancy and compare its performance with conventional insulin resistance (IR) indices. Methods: This prospective investigation evaluated 1450 Chinese gravidas (<12 gestational weeks) without pregestational diabetes from two obstetrical institutions. Baseline clinical-biochemical profiling occurred during the first trimester (6-12 weeks), with GDM confirmation via standardized 75g oral glucose tolerance testing at 24-28 weeks' gestation. Analytical methodologies incorporated multivariable regression modeling and ROC curve optimization to quantify the predictive validity of five metabolic indices (METS-IR, TyG index, TG/HDL-C ratio, HOMA-IR, TyG-BMI) for GDM risk stratification. Results: Among participants, 378 (26.1%) developed GDM. The GDM group (n=378, 26.1%) was older (median age 31.0 vs 30.0 years, p<0.0001) and had higher prepregnancy BMI (22.62 vs 21.32 kg/m², p<0.0001), fasting glucose (4.7 vs 4.5 mmol/L, p<0.0001) compared to NGT. The GDM group exhibited significantly higher METS-IR (31.14 vs 29.03, p <0.001) and other IR indices (p <0.001).
